2 definitions found

From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:

  Diclinous \Dic"li*nous\, a. [Gr. ? = ? bed.]
     Having the stamens and pistils in separate flowers. --Gray.
     [1913 Webster]

From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:



  diclinous
       adj : having pistils and stamens in separate flowers [ant: {monoclinous}]
